Output 4e149ca77c805c29e1cffe416918d0a56d1bffba79e940f616ce7f7182c9c905:53

value
86852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d666fe9c20ae0fca2e1d4dd15de7d054ed12ba7 OP_EQUAL
address
3Eafv3tGb6m8PS1jwTuPqnoeQWe2ky4T1h
transaction
4e149ca77c805c29e1cffe416918d0a56d1bffba79e940f616ce7f7182c9c905